Start by asking other musicians to recommend a sound engineer with expertise in creating appealing sounds. Musicians will share details of producers with years of experience and pleasing track record for producing impressive sounds.

Location is a factor many musicians overlook during their search for music production companies. Think about the comfort level you desire when creating music. You want a quiet and appealing environment to relax and create quality audios. Consider working in a music facility situated in the country. Make sure the facility is fitted with different amenities to enhance comfort.

The size of the studio matters a lot when recording music. Check the size of the facility beforehand. Think about the number of people featured in your music. This will help you determine if the facility has sufficient space. Another important consideration is sound. Ask for samples before signing a contract to ensure the sound produced fits your music.

There are various types of musical instruments designed for different audio production. Take time to learn how different instruments function. The internet is a good source of information. Browse through different music production firms to find out the type of instruments they use. You will come across studios with a long list of instruments, but it does not mean they offer quality results. Choose a company with expertise on how to operate both analog and digital instruments.

Understanding the costs is the first step to selecting a company worth your time and resources. Review the price estimates given by several companies in the region. Ask producers to break down costs as indicated by estimates. Remember, expensive companies will not always provide excellent work. Choose a company that meets your needs and fits your budget. Find out if you are paying an hourly rate or fixed amount.

Music production is not as easy as it sounds. Sound engineers spend time editing tracks, arranging music content and rehearsing. Producers usually recommend an hour or two for rehearsal. Depending on the nature of your music, producers will schedule rehearsal and content management every day for a specific duration.
